Just mentioning that Q300 is actually not quiet at all after a year, after all the cheap fiberglass inside has burned off. Mine now sounds like an empty tin can - VERY loud, with plenty of rasp and blat. If you wanna buy a loud, broken-in Q300 system I'll be selling mine cheap!

Any catback with a single large muffler will accomplish your goals.

I had the same exhaust setup you currently have. Catless header with a Nameless catted front pipe and the stock exhaust. With this I noticed that the car had tremendous amounts of rasp, and only sounded good in the low RPMs. It sounded like my stock muffler was getting overloaded from how high flow the rest of my exhaust was.

I thought the fix would be to cut the stock resonator from the stock catback. This made the car sound so bad I was too ashamed to even take a video to share it with anyone.

I ended up getting the Greddy Supreme SP catback and it compliments the other exhaust parts very nicely. I think this exhaust is about as quiet as the Q300.

These are the catbacks I'd be looking at:
1. CSG/MXP exhaust
2. Greddy Supreme SP
3. Invidia Q300
4. Perrin 2.5" resonatede
5. Miltek Sport
